The application can measure and display graphically the magnetic induction intensity around the mobile phone. The statistics of the magnetic induction intensity over a period of time, such as the mean, maximum and minimum, can be given in real-time. If the peak above a certain threshold, the sound and vibration alarm will be activated. Main functions: 1. Track detecting electromagnetic field intensity around mobile phone; 2. Statistics data of magnetic induction intensity over a period of time; 3. If the changes of the magnetic induction intensity beyond the threshold, the alarm will be activated; 4. Support iOS 6.0 and above; support iPhone and iPad; 5. No ads, no internet, no IAP. Application scenarios: 1.The baby's room: electromagnetic radiation intensity and distribution of detection, to avoid the high strength area; 2. Office space: electromagnetic radiant point detection; 3. Bedroom(especially the head of a bed) :electromagnetic radiation detection, if high the beds should be adjusted; 4. Testing of baggage and parcel electronic equipment or iron metal. Note: 1. Magnetic induction B is equal to the value of the magnetic field perpendicular to the direction of the long 1m, current size of straight wire 1A suffered magnetic force. 2. Magnetic induction’s value is related with the iOS device, in the same environment, different devices may get different measurement results. 3. The magnetic induction intensity has directivity, iOS device’s direction will affect the measurement result. 4. The magnetic induction intensity is related with the distance from the radiation source. The smaller the distance, the greater the radiation value. 5. Generally, if the magnetic induction intensity is too high or dramatic changes, it will have a greater impact on the human body. 6. The magnetic induction intensity will affect the human’s health. Different countries or regions have different electromagnetic radiation exposure limits, the main signal frequency, size and exposure duration. Please refer to the relevant standards.}
